Job Summary
Work Hours: Second Shift, 4:00 PM to 12:00 AM, Monday - Friday, overtime as needed
Primary responsibility of this position is the daily operation and maintenance of the Anti-Reflective Coating machines. This process applies anti-reflective coating to prescription lenses. The Walman team provides full training so that each employee is comfortable with safe operation of the equipment and process of completing quality eyewear and ability to meet production goals.
Duties
- Operate Anti-Reflective Coating machines.
- Daily and weekly maintenance of equipment involved in the A/R coating process.
- Troubleshoot and call for technical support on all equipment involved.
- Final inspect lenses, ensure coating meets desired specification.
- Sandblast parts as needed.
- Ability to perform all other aspects of the A/R coating process.
